AHA podcast: A Great Catch — Strategies for Building a Culture of Safety Reporting

Mindy Estes, M.D., former CEO of Saint Luke’s Health System and former AHA board chair, and Nancy Howell Agee, CEO emeritus of Carilion Clinic and former AHA board chair, discuss the importance of bringing a culture of safety reporting to an organization and how technology cannot replace the human factor in a successful patient safety strategy.
